Resizing Your Image

Adjust the image size using the resizing handles (small squares) around the image, or by entering specific dimensions in the 'Width' and 'Height' fields. Maintain the aspect ratio for a proportionate image.

Positioning Your Image

Click 'Wrap text' to place text around your image. Choose either 'In line with text' (image flows with text) or 'Behind text' (text displayed on top of the image). You can also adjust the position using the alignment icons near the 'Wrap text' button.
